CGT at RHS Flower Show Tatton Park 2012
In 2012, our Show Garden Time and Tide: Caldwell’s and Canute won a much coveted silver medal. Designed by award-winning garden designer, Jacquetta Menzies, our garden was inspired by the Trust’s Caldwell’s Nurseries Project. Cheshire artist, Christine Wilcox-Baker, conceived a magnificent
stainless-steel sculpture of the King Canute which presided over the
garden.

Update: Since 2015 King Canute has a new home outside Knutsford Council Offices.
Update 2: 2021 King Canute has been added to the on-line Register of Public Artworks - Art UK
